Created attachment 1193457 [details] rhsm.log for 100 configure files Description of problem: We try to create 100 same configure files in /etc/virt-who.d for rhevm mode performance testing, that means virt-who will create 100 PIDs and fetch the hosts/guests info from RHEVM Server, some of the PIDs failed with "Unable to connect to RHEV-M server: 503 Server Error: Service Unavailable"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): virt-who-0.17-7.el7.noarch subscription-manager-1.17.10-1.el7.x86_64 How reproducible: always Steps to Reproduce: 1.create 100 configure files in /etc/virt-who.d for rhevm mode 2.run virt-who with oneshot option and check rhsm.log, many PIDs failed due to the following error: 2016-08-22 22:27:14,698 [virtwho.test-rhevm_1 ERROR] RhevM-1(8732):MainThread @virt.py:run:375 - Virt backend 'test-rhevm_1' fails with error: Unable to connect to RHEV-M server: 503 Server Error: Service Unavailable Actual results: some of the PIDs failed with "Unable to connect to RHEV-M server: 503 Server Error: Service Unavailable" Expected results: All the virt-who PIDs can fetch the host/guests info normally Additional info:
Given that virt-who connects to the same hypervisor 100 times in parallel, it's quite expected that one hypervisor won't be able to handle all the requests. Please retry with more than one hypervisor. As I see it now, this is not a bug.
one rhevm server can't handle so many virt-who PIDs at the same time, deploy 5 rhevm servers for testing, no error info found
